mysql怎么創(chuàng)建關聯(lián)表 mysql表關聯(lián)查詢都有什么方式

mysql數(shù)據(jù)庫表之間是怎么關聯(lián)的?請詳解

首先我們打開Workbench創(chuàng)一個建數(shù)據(jù)庫(這里都使用閃電1執(zhí)行選定命令行)。先創(chuàng)建Student學生表。再創(chuàng)建course課程表。然后就可以創(chuàng)建sc關聯(lián)表了我們先寫上Student的主鍵和course的主鍵,并寫上sc自己的屬性成績。

成都網(wǎng)絡公司-成都網(wǎng)站建設公司成都創(chuàng)新互聯(lián)10多年經(jīng)驗成就非凡,專業(yè)從事網(wǎng)站設計制作、網(wǎng)站建設,成都網(wǎng)頁設計,成都網(wǎng)頁制作,軟文營銷,一元廣告等。10多年來已成功提供全面的成都網(wǎng)站建設方案,打造行業(yè)特色的成都網(wǎng)站建設案例,建站熱線:18982081108,我們期待您的來電!

首先,創(chuàng)建一個測試表,如下圖所示,然后進入下一步。其次,插入測試數(shù)據(jù),如下圖所示,然后進入下一步。

現(xiàn)在的數(shù)據(jù)庫基本都是關系數(shù)據(jù)庫,表與表之間的關聯(lián)一般都是靠字段來維持的。

數(shù)據(jù)庫多表關聯(lián),一般采用外鍵比較方便,也可以額外建一個連接表做多表關聯(lián)的連接,但這樣稍微有點兒復雜,這些是建表方面的關聯(lián)。

flag, see docs: “ Numeric Types”)出現(xiàn)如下頁面 接下來向建好的tb_student表中添加數(shù)據(jù) 右鍵點擊tb_student,再點擊select rows limit 1000 在mysql workbench中向數(shù)據(jù)庫中的表中添加數(shù)據(jù)大致就是這個樣子。

在數(shù)據(jù)庫窗口中,單擊“創(chuàng)建”中“表格”中的“表設計”,打開表設計窗口。按照需要設計表“1”的表結構,完成后關閉表設計,命名表1為“1”按需求確定字段大小以及是否允許空填。重復上述操作,建立表“2”。

mysql怎么做2張表關聯(lián),大哥們進

1、高級SQL語句INNERJOIN非常實用在接觸這個語句之前我要到數(shù)據(jù)庫查詢不同表的內容我一般需要執(zhí)行2次sql語句循環(huán)2次。

2、首先,創(chuàng)建一個測試表,如下圖所示,然后進入下一步。其次,插入測試數(shù)據(jù),如下圖所示,然后進入下一步。

3、left join join 主外鍵是兩種對表的約束。

4、Select b.* from a,b where a.id=8976 and a.xid=b.id 這樣就好了,查詢出來的是b表的內容,關聯(lián)條件是xid和b表的id。

mysql怎么讓2個表關聯(lián)起來

高級SQL語句INNERJOIN非常實用在接觸這個語句之前我要到數(shù)據(jù)庫查詢不同表的內容我一般需要執(zhí)行2次sql語句循環(huán)2次。

首先我們打開Workbench創(chuàng)一個建數(shù)據(jù)庫(這里都使用閃電1執(zhí)行選定命令行)。先創(chuàng)建Student學生表。再創(chuàng)建course課程表。然后就可以創(chuàng)建sc關聯(lián)表了我們先寫上Student的主鍵和course的主鍵,并寫上sc自己的屬性成績。

可以用兩表的查詢結果集做為一個虛擬表(為其取一個表別名),然后再用該虛擬表與另一張表實施連接查詢即可。

left join join 主外鍵是兩種對表的約束。

你好,你的這個需求可以通過,觸發(fā)器實現(xiàn)。觸發(fā)器就可以在指定的表的數(shù)據(jù)發(fā)生增加,刪除,修改時,完成一定的功能。

文章名稱:mysql怎么創(chuàng)建關聯(lián)表 mysql表關聯(lián)查詢都有什么方式
瀏覽地址:http://muchs.cn/article8/dishoip.html

成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供小程序開發(fā)、網(wǎng)站制作、品牌網(wǎng)站設計、網(wǎng)站設計公司、商城網(wǎng)站、定制開發(fā)

廣告

聲明:本網(wǎng)站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經(jīng)允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)

小程序開發(fā)